It's hard for IT professionals to get away
from work to train; 44% of IT workers cite
work demands as the reason it's difficult to
formally train. Recall the earlier data point
that of the 58% of IT decision-makers who
have a training budget, only 60 percent
authorized training. This demonstrates a
tremendous disconnect, because 85%
of IT professionals reported some level
of training this past year. IT professionals
don't sit back and wait; they make things
happen. They're training with what's
available. Some are even spending their
own money. Why are IT professionals
having to moonlight their skills
development when their organization is
struggling against a skills crisis?

There will always be some level of
skills gap, but leaders responsible for
skills development need to rethink how
they manage development for their
teams and organization. In concert with
listening to their people, leaders need
to assess, manage, and address skills
gaps and needs based on the criticality
and complexity of a skill set when
determining how to train.
